2. LinkedIn Headline Optimization Prompt
Prompt:
Act as a LinkedIn headline expert who helps professionals create clear, keyword-rich, and attractive profile headlines.
I want you to rewrite my LinkedIn headline so it sounds professional, credible, and aligned with my career or business goal.
My details:
- Current headline: [Paste your current LinkedIn headline]
- Current role: [Your current role]
- Industry or niche: [Your industry]
- Main skills: [Skill 1, Skill 2, Skill 3]
- Target audience: [Recruiters / clients / business owners / startups / HR managers / etc.]
- Main goal: [Get hired / attract clients / build personal brand / generate leads]
- Personality style: [Professional / friendly / bold / simple / premium / creative]
- Achievements or proof: [Example: 5+ years experience, helped 20+ clients, certified in X, managed $X budget]
Create 10 LinkedIn headline options using different styles:
- Professional and corporate
- Recruiter-friendly
- Client-attracting
- Keyword-rich
- Short and simple
- Authority-building
- Results-focused
- Personal brand style
- Modern and engaging
- Best overall version
For each headline, explain why it works and which type of audience it is best for.
Avoid vague words like “hardworking,” “motivated,” or “passionate” unless they add real value.

7. LinkedIn Experience Section Optimization Prompt
Prompt:
Act as a LinkedIn resume and profile optimization expert.
Help me rewrite my LinkedIn Experience section so it sounds achievement-focused, professional, and easy to understand.
Here is my information:
- Job title: [Your job title]
- Company: [Company name]
- Employment dates: [Start date – End date / Present]
- Industry: [Industry]
- Main responsibilities: [List your responsibilities]
- Key achievements: [List measurable achievements if possible]
- Tools used: [Tools, software, platforms]
- Skills used: [Main skills]
- Target role or audience: [Recruiters / clients / hiring managers]
- Tone: [Professional / concise / detailed / executive]
Please rewrite this Experience section in LinkedIn-friendly format.
Include:
- A short role summary
- 5–7 bullet points focused on results
- Strong action verbs
- Relevant keywords
- Metrics where possible
- A version for recruiters
- A version for clients
- A simplified beginner-friendly version
- Suggestions for missing details I should add
- A final polished version ready to paste into LinkedIn
Do not exaggerate. Keep it truthful and professional.
